Google starts using maker finding out to aid with spell check at scale in Search.

Google launches Google Translate using machine discovering to instantly equate languages, beginning with Arabic-English and English-Arabic.

A new era of AI begins when Google researchers enhance speech recognition with Deep Neural Networks, which is a brand-new device discovering architecture loosely modeled after the neural structures in the human brain.

In the well-known "cat paper," Google Research begins using big sets of "unlabeled information," like videos and pictures from the web, to significantly enhance AI image classification. Roughly comparable to human learning, the neural network acknowledges images (including cats!) from direct exposure rather of direct guideline.

Introduced in the term paper "Distributed Representations of Words and Phrases and their Compositionality," Word2Vec catalyzed basic development in natural language processing-- going on to be pointed out more than 40,000 times in the years following, and winning the NeurIPS 2023 "Test of Time" Award.

AtariDQN is the first Deep Learning model to effectively learn control policies straight from high-dimensional sensory input utilizing support knowing. It played Atari games from simply the raw pixel input at a level that superpassed a human professional.

Google provides Sequence To Sequence Learning With Neural Networks, an effective machine discovering method that can find out to equate languages and sum up text by checking out words one at a time and remembering what it has checked out in the past.

Google obtains DeepMind, among the leading AI research labs worldwide.

Google deploys RankBrain in Search and Ads supplying a better understanding of how words connect to ideas.

Distillation enables intricate models to run in production by lowering their size and latency, while keeping the majority of the performance of bigger, more computationally expensive models. It has actually been utilized to improve Google Search and Smart Summary for Gmail, Chat, Docs, and more.

At its annual I/O developers conference, Google introduces Google Photos, a brand-new app that utilizes AI with search capability to look for and gain access to your memories by the individuals, places, and things that matter.

Google introduces TensorFlow, a brand-new, scalable open source maker learning structure utilized in speech acknowledgment.

Google Research proposes a new, decentralized approach to training AI called Federated Learning that promises enhanced security and scalability.

AlphaGo, a computer program developed by DeepMind, plays the famous Lee Sedol, winner of 18 world titles, famous for his imagination and extensively thought about to be among the best players of the past years. During the games, AlphaGo played a number of innovative winning moves. In game 2, it played Move 37 - an innovative move assisted AlphaGo win the game and overthrew centuries of standard wisdom.

Developed by scientists at DeepMind, WaveNet is a new deep neural network for generating raw audio waveforms enabling it to model natural sounding speech. WaveNet was used to design many of the voices of the Google Assistant and other Google services.

Google announces the Google Neural Machine Translation system (GNMT), which uses cutting edge training methods to attain the largest enhancements to date for machine translation quality.

In a paper published in the Journal of the American Medical Association, Google demonstrates that a machine-learning driven system for diagnosing diabetic retinopathy from a retinal image might carry out on-par with board-certified ophthalmologists.

Google launches "Attention Is All You Need," a research paper that presents the Transformer, an unique neural network architecture particularly well fit for language understanding, amongst lots of other things.

Introduced DeepVariant, an open-source genomic alternative caller that significantly improves the accuracy of identifying alternative locations. This development in Genomics has actually contributed to the fastest ever human genome sequencing, and assisted produce the world's very first human pangenome recommendation.

Google Research launches JAX - a Python library designed for high-performance numerical computing, especially device learning research.

Google announces Smart Compose, a new function in Gmail that uses AI to help users quicker respond to their email. Smart Compose develops on Smart Reply, another AI feature.

Google releases its AI Principles - a set of guidelines that the business follows when establishing and utilizing synthetic intelligence. The concepts are developed to ensure that AI is used in such a way that is beneficial to society and respects human rights.

Google presents a new technique for natural language processing pre-training called Bidirectional Encoder Representations from Transformers (BERT), helping Search better comprehend users' questions.

AlphaZero, a general reinforcement discovering algorithm, masters chess, shogi, and Go through self-play.

Google's Quantum AI shows for the first time a computational job that can be performed exponentially faster on a quantum processor than on the world's fastest classical computer-- simply 200 seconds on a quantum processor compared to the 10,000 years it would handle a classical gadget.

Google Research proposes using maker discovering itself to assist in creating computer system chip hardware to accelerate the design process.

DeepMind's AlphaFold is recognized as a solution to the 50-year "protein-folding problem." AlphaFold can precisely predict 3D designs of protein structures and is accelerating research in biology. This work went on to get a Nobel Prize in Chemistry in 2024.

GraphCast, an AI design for faster and more precise worldwide weather forecasting, is presented.

GNoME - a deep learning tool - is utilized to discover 2.2 million new crystals, including 380,000 stable products that could power future technologies.

Google introduces Gemini, our most capable and general model, systemcheck-wiki.de developed from the ground up to be multimodal. Gemini is able to generalize and seamlessly comprehend, run throughout, and integrate different kinds of details consisting of text, code, audio, image and video.

Google broadens the Gemini community to present a brand-new generation: Gemini 1.5, and brings Gemini to more products like Gmail and Docs. Gemini Advanced launched, giving people access to Google's many capable AI models.

Gemma is a household of lightweight state-of-the art open designs developed from the exact same research and technology used to develop the Gemini models.

Introduced AlphaFold 3, a brand-new AI design developed by Google DeepMind and Isomorphic Labs that anticipates the structure of proteins, DNA, RNA, ligands and more. Scientists can access the majority of its abilities, for totally free, through AlphaFold Server.

Google Research and Harvard released the very first synaptic-resolution restoration of the human brain. This achievement, enabled by the fusion of clinical imaging and Google's AI algorithms, paves the method for discoveries about brain function.

NeuralGCM, a brand-new device learning-based method to simulating Earth's atmosphere, is introduced. Developed in partnership with the European Centre for Medium-Range Weather Report (ECMWF), NeuralGCM integrates traditional physics-based modeling with ML for improved simulation precision and effectiveness.

Our combined AlphaProof and AlphaGeometry 2 systems fixed 4 out of six problems from the 2024 International Mathematical Olympiad (IMO), attaining the exact same level as a silver medalist in the competition for the very first time. The IMO is the earliest, biggest and most prestigious competition for young mathematicians, and has likewise ended up being commonly acknowledged as a grand obstacle in artificial intelligence.
